Wiha 8pc Screwdriver set
I was working on my car one weekend using regular screwdrivers you would buy from any hardware store, I found myself in a situation where i needed to pry away fairly thick sheet aluminum that was bent and in the way. I ended up breaking 4 screwdriver tips before finally giving up and ended up buying a pry bar to finish the work. Disappointed, I started looking at options out there and thats when I ran into a forum highly talking about the quality of Wiha screwdrivers. I knew that I had to give it a try myself.Initially, I was thinking that its probably gonna be a few bucks, but when I found out that it was over $100 it was definitely out of my price range, especially for screwdrivers. A few months go buy and I find myself again in need of a good screwdriver that wont just strip under hard use. Thats when I again ran into the Wiha name. I finally took a leap of faith to buy them. ABSOLUTELY no regrets!! these are defintely the best screwdrivers I have ever used bar none. I really wish I had the money to buy more Wiha products.QualityThe tips are very well machined. When looking for screwdrivers, this is the first thing I look at, they fit into screws like a glove with absolutely no slippage. It is made of a high quality Chrome-vanadium-molybdenum hardened steel. Unlike most companies, the blade actually extends through the handle all the way to the steel striking cap giving you that much more confidence that this thing will take a beating. The handles feel great in my hand with or without gloves. It is made of a type of "cellulose acetate" material which is non-slip as well as oil and grease resistant which is a great plus for those who loves to work on cars. To top it all off, they even add a hex bolster to give more added torque with a wrench if needed! its little details like this that makes Wiha stand apart from others.UseUpon receiving this set, I immediately used them while pulling out my transmission. with the microfinished handles, the first thing I noticed was the torque gain. It was amazing how effortlessly it was to get out even the stubborn screws. As I mentioned above, the machining on the tips are superb and it makes using them easy. I used to have to put in alot of pressure to assure that the screwdriver wont slip out, with these, I hardly need to do that, very minimal effort. A++Tip: Buy the Wiha Magnetizer/Demagnetizer to go with them, Very cheap and it makes jobs in hard places very easy by magnetizing/demagnetizing within seconds.ConclusionsBy far the best screwdrivers I have ever used. I would absolutely recommend them to anyone who has the budget for them. Its a little bit more expensive than most companies, but what won me over was the fact that its for a lifetime investment, no more need to replace broken screwdrivers because they are going to last you forever so long as you don't lose them.ConsThe only real con that I can find is that it is a bit steep as far as price goes. But I doubt anyone would be disappointed with the actual product.One other thing that some others may think is a con is the weight. They do weigh more than a standard screwdriver (probably the weight of 2 standard screwdrivers at most), but then again, you have to factor in that it has a steel striking cap as well as better quality. Honestly, although it weighs more, I dont feel any of it when using it.Five out of five stars. Highly Recommended and would buy again

B**N
Something different
High price point set, high quality also. I bought these to replace my snap on screwdriver set at work. Weight can sometimes be an indicator of quality, and these have a great weight to them. A few things I dislike about this set is, there is no color matching stubby screwdrivers, you'll have to buy a set of red stubby's. Also there's 3 Phillips and 5 flat heads for some odd reason, I would've liked to see another #2 Phillips included with a longer shank and larger grip.

the BEST that money can buy
Great feel in hand and superior fit and finish. It is easy to take pride in owning these babies! I love Wiha tools overall, and compared to the Wera brand KraftForm (which I also own) these are MUCH more heavy duty. I keep these in my toolbox for working on automotive projects, whereas the Wera ones are not as nice fit and finish and perfect for a hobbyist.The handles on these clean up easily with a quick spray of brake cleaner and the markings are very hard to remove. The grips are very comfy and the microfinish still lets you grip with oily gloves or hands. The phillips tips make it VERY difficult to strip bolts because they are hardened so well and fit so nicely. These things have the perfect weight to them that let you know you are using quality, professional tools. Buy these once and never regret it.
